Bacteria Pathogen, Virus Pathogen in the Global Autogenous Vaccine For Aquaculture Market:

Bacteria pathogens and virus pathogens are two primary categories of infectious agents that significantly impact the Global Autogenous Vaccine for Aquaculture Market. Bacterial pathogens such as Aeromonas, Vibrio, and Streptococcus species are common culprits in aquaculture environments. These bacteria can cause a range of diseases, including ulcers, septicemia, and gill infections, which can lead to high mortality rates and significant economic losses. Autogenous vaccines targeting these bacterial pathogens are developed by isolating the specific strain causing the disease outbreak in a particular farm, inactivating it, and then using it to immunize the affected population. This tailored approach ensures that the vaccine is highly specific and effective against the prevalent strain, thereby providing better protection compared to commercial vaccines that may not cover all local strains. On the other hand, virus pathogens such as Infectious Hematopoietic Necrosis Virus (IHNV), Viral Hemorrhagic Septicemia Virus (VHSV), and Koi Herpesvirus (KHV) pose significant challenges in aquaculture. These viruses can spread rapidly through water and infected fish, leading to devastating outbreaks. Autogenous vaccines for viral pathogens are developed similarly to bacterial vaccines, by isolating the virus from the affected population, inactivating it, and using it to create a vaccine. However, developing viral vaccines can be more complex due to the nature of viruses and their ability to mutate rapidly. Despite these challenges, autogenous viral vaccines have shown promise in controlling outbreaks and reducing the impact of viral diseases in aquaculture. Antibiotics, Expectorants, Others in the Global Bronchiectasis Therapeutic Market:

Antibiotics play a crucial role in the Global Bronchiectasis Therapeutic Market as they are often the first line of defense against infections that can exacerbate the condition. These medications work by targeting and eliminating the bacteria responsible for infections, thereby reducing inflammation and preventing further damage to the airways. Commonly used antibiotics for bronchiectasis include macrolides, fluoroquinolones, and beta-lactams. Macrolides, such as azithromycin and clarithromycin, are known for their anti-inflammatory properties in addition to their antibacterial effects, making them particularly beneficial for long-term management. Fluoroquinolones, like ciprofloxacin and levofloxacin, are often reserved for more severe infections due to their broad-spectrum activity. Beta-lactams, including amoxicillin and cephalosporins, are frequently used for their effectiveness against a wide range of bacteria. Expectorants are another vital component of bronchiectasis therapy, as they help to thin and loosen mucus in the airways, making it easier for patients to cough it up and clear their lungs. Medications such as guaifenesin are commonly prescribed expectorants that can significantly improve mucus clearance and reduce the risk of infections. In addition to antibiotics and expectorants, other treatments play a significant role in managing bronchiectasis. Bronchodilators, for instance, help to open up the airways, making it easier for patients to breathe. These medications can be short-acting, providing quick relief from symptoms, or long-acting, offering sustained benefits over time. Inhaled corticosteroids are also used to reduce inflammation in the airways, although their use is typically reserved for patients with coexisting conditions like asthma or chronic obstructive pulmonary disease (COPD). Mucolytics, such as acetylcysteine, are another category of medications that help to break down mucus, further aiding in its clearance from the lungs. Additionally, airway clearance techniques, including chest physiotherapy and the use of devices like positive expiratory pressure (PEP) masks, are often recommended to enhance the effectiveness of pharmacological treatments. Blood Enzyme Test, Blood Chemistry Test, Blood Clotting Test in the Global Blood Volume Analyzer Market:

Blood enzyme tests, blood chemistry tests, and blood clotting tests are integral components of the Global Blood Volume Analyzer Market, each serving distinct yet complementary roles in patient care. Blood enzyme tests measure the levels of specific enzymes in the blood, which can indicate the presence of certain medical conditions. For example, elevated levels of cardiac enzymes can signal a heart attack, while abnormal liver enzyme levels may suggest liver disease. These tests are essential for diagnosing acute conditions and monitoring chronic diseases, providing critical information that guides treatment decisions. Blood chemistry tests, on the other hand, analyze the chemical components of the blood, such as electrolytes, glucose, and lipids. These tests are vital for assessing overall health, diagnosing metabolic disorders, and monitoring the effectiveness of treatments. For instance, blood glucose tests are crucial for managing diabetes, while lipid profiles help evaluate cardiovascular risk. Blood clotting tests, also known as coagulation tests, measure the blood's ability to clot and are essential for diagnosing bleeding disorders, monitoring anticoagulant therapy, and assessing surgical risk. Conditions like hemophilia, deep vein thrombosis, and pulmonary embolism require precise coagulation monitoring to ensure effective and safe treatment. Smartwatches, Wristbands, Skin Patches, Smart Shoes And Socks, Contact Lenses in the Global Wearable Glucometers Market:

Smartwatches, wristbands, skin patches, smart shoes and socks, and contact lenses are some of the innovative products in the Global Wearable Glucometers Market. Smartwatches equipped with glucometer functions offer a seamless way to monitor blood glucose levels. These devices often come with additional health tracking features such as heart rate monitoring, sleep tracking, and fitness tracking, making them multifunctional health companions. Wristbands, similar to smartwatches, provide continuous glucose monitoring and can be worn comfortably throughout the day. They are designed to be discreet and user-friendly, often syncing with mobile apps to provide real-time data and alerts. Skin patches are another revolutionary product in this market. These patches adhere to the skin and use sensors to measure glucose levels in the interstitial fluid. They are minimally invasive and can provide continuous monitoring for several days before needing to be replaced. Smart shoes and socks are designed to monitor glucose levels through the skin on the feet. These products are particularly useful for individuals with diabetic neuropathy, as they can also monitor foot health and detect early signs of complications. Contact lenses with glucose monitoring capabilities are still in the experimental stage but hold great promise. These lenses measure glucose levels in the tear fluid and can provide continuous monitoring without the need for blood samples. Optical Technology, Infrared Technology in the Global Portable Pyrometer Market:

Optical technology and infrared technology are two primary methods used in the global portable pyrometer market. Optical pyrometers, also known as radiation pyrometers, measure temperature based on the visible light emitted by an object. These devices are particularly useful for measuring extremely high temperatures, such as those found in metal forging or glass production. Optical pyrometers are known for their accuracy and ability to measure temperatures from a distance, making them ideal for applications where direct contact with the object is not possible or safe. On the other hand, infrared pyrometers measure temperature based on the infrared radiation emitted by an object. Infrared technology is highly versatile and can be used in a wide range of applications, from industrial processes to HVAC systems. Infrared pyrometers are valued for their quick response time and ability to measure temperature in real-time, which is crucial for maintaining process efficiency and safety. Both optical and infrared pyrometers have their unique advantages and are chosen based on the specific requirements of the application. For instance, in the glass industry, where temperatures can exceed 1000°C, optical pyrometers are often preferred for their ability to measure high temperatures accurately. In contrast, infrared pyrometers are commonly used in the HVAC industry for their ability to quickly and accurately measure surface temperatures. The choice between optical and infrared technology depends on factors such as the temperature range, the environment in which the pyrometer will be used, and the level of accuracy required.
